This print showcases a remarkable artifact from ancient Egypt, specifically the Second Intermediate Period during Dynasty 15 (approximately 1650-1550 BCE). The image features a beautifully carved scarab beetle made of steatite, symbolizing rebirth and eternity in Egyptian culture. What makes this piece truly intriguing is the intricate detail of two cobras addorsed and linked on top of the scarab.
